Output efb394e208e132b1d84e1dfd351ce9918355fc13cdf2eb528c5f38b6765e44d0:54

value
30809046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 372c855a409ab9b86155caba155459a3dc034846 OP_EQUAL
address
MCvtjM8Gt9GGVbU21vCWpaXXS5Tn1MbGxc
transaction
efb394e208e132b1d84e1dfd351ce9918355fc13cdf2eb528c5f38b6765e44d0
spent
true